10.4 CANopen
Please use only CAN certified cable with the following characteristics:
Parameter
Value
Impedance 120
Ω
± 12
Ω
Capacity
< 50 pF/m
Table 69: Characteristics of CAN certified Cable
Figure 13: Termination CANopen Network
The pin numbers inthe figure above refer to M12 connectors. If you use de-
vices in the network with other types of connectors, take care that the pin
numbers of those devices can be different from the figure above.
At the ends of the network there must be two resistors of 120
Ω
to termi-
nate the cable. It is allowed to use repeaters to increase the number of
nodes, which may be connected, or to increase the maximum cable length.
The CAN segment length in dependence of the Baud rate or corresponding
Loop Resistance and Wire Gauge is given in the following table:
